The procedure of conscription for military service in Ukraine
Introduction
Military service is an important duty of a citizen of Ukraine. The conscription procedure, defined by legislation, regulates the procedure for attracting citizens to the ranks of the Armed Forces. Understanding this procedure is key for both prospective recruits and the general public. In this article, we will consider in detail the main stages of conscription for military service in Ukraine.
Legislative framework
The conscription of citizens of Ukraine for military service is regulated by a number of legislative acts, key among which are the Law of Ukraine "On Military Duty and Military Service" and the Regulations on the Military Service of Ukrainian Citizens in the Armed Forces of Ukraine.
According to the current legislation, all male citizens of Ukraine aged 18 to 27 who are deemed fit for military service are subject to military service.Women can be called up for military service at their own will.
Citizens who have the right to deferment or exemption from conscription are not subject to conscription. Such categories include, in particular, persons who study at higher educational institutions, have family responsibilities, undergo alternative (non-military) service, or are recognized as unfit due to their health.
Recruitment process
The procedure of conscription for military service consists of several stages:
- Registration for military registration
-Male citizens of Ukraine are subject to military registration at the age of 16-17. For this, they must undergo a medical examination and submit the necessary documents to the conscription station at their place of residence.
- Registration at the conscription station
- After reaching the age of 18, citizens are obliged to register for primary military registration at their place of residence. This process is called "enlistment" and involves issuing a conscript's identity card, obtaining an enrollment certificate and determining suitability for military service.
-Medical examination and determination of fitness category
-During the medical examination, the conscripts undergo an in-depth examination of their state of health.According to its results, they are assigned one of five categories of fitness for military service: "A" (fit), "B" (temporarily unfit), "B" (limited fit), "G" (unfit) and "D" " (not applicable).
Call for the draft commission
Conscripts deemed fit for health are summoned to a meeting of the draft commission. The commission examines the documents of each conscript, determines his suitability for military service and makes a decision on conscription or postponement.
Sending to military units
Conscripts, in respect of whom a decision on conscription has been made, receive summonses and are sent to military commissariats to be sent to military units. They go through the appropriate registration procedure and psychological preparation before sending.
Alternative (non-military) service
Citizens of Ukraine have the right to undergo alternative (non-military) service instead of regular military service. Alternative service provides for work in the fields of health care, education, social protection, environmental protection and other areas.
Citizens who cannot participate in military operations due to their religious beliefs have the right to alternative service. To do this, they submit an application to the draft commission before the start of the draft.
The conscription commission considers applications and makes a decision on the referral of citizens to alternative service. The duration of alternative service is 18 months for civil service and 24 months for service in special institutions.
Citizens undergoing alternative service have the same rights and obligations as conscripts, in particular with regard to social protection, benefits, compensation, etc.
